Safety and Responsible Boating
Enjoying time on a boat requires attention to safety practices, from life jackets to weather checks. Operators should review local regulations, monitor conditions, and communicate clear rules to passengers before departure.
Highlighting responsible behavior in content adds credibility and encourages followers to prioritize caution while still having fun. Simple checklists and preparatory routines can make recreation safer and more enjoyable.

What equipment do I need to capture high-quality clips while on a boat?
Use a waterproof phone case or action camera, a portable power bank, and a stabilizer mount for steady footage.
How can I protect my privacy when posting location tags related to boating outings?
Limit location visibility to trusted followers, disable location services for sensitive apps, and avoid posting real-time whereabouts.
Are there copyright concerns when using trending music on boating videos?
Yes, verify platform licensing, use original audio when possible, and credit tracks to reduce potential infringement issues.
